Job Summary: The Executive Secretary provides high-level administrative support to the Chief Executive Officer (CEO), 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of the executive’s day-to-day activities. The role requires a proactive, highly organized, and confidential professional who can handle a wide range of tasks, manage complex schedules, and assist in various business functions., * Calendar Management:

  • Coordinate and manage the CEO’s schedule, including appointments, meetings, and travel arrangements.

  • Prioritize and resolve scheduling conflicts, ensuring the CEO’s time is used efficiently.

  • Communication:

  • Act as the primary point of contact between the CEO and internal/external stakeholders.

  • Draft, proofread, and manage correspondence and communication on behalf of the CEO.

  • Handle phone calls, emails, and other communications with discretion and professionalism.

  • Meeting Coordination:

  • Organize and schedule meetings, including preparing agendas, arranging logistics, and taking minutes.

  • Follow up on action items and ensure deadlines are met.

  • Travel Arrangements:

  • Plan and coordinate travel itineraries, including booking flights, accommodations, and transportation.

  • Prepare travel documents and ensure all arrangements align with the CEO’s preferences and schedule.

  • Administrative Support:

  • Manage and maintain confidential files and documents.

  • Prepare reports, presentations, and other documents as needed.

  • Conduct research and compile information for meetings and decision-making.

  • Project Assistance:

  • Assist in the management and execution of special projects and initiatives.

  • Track progress and report on project status to ensure timely completion.

  • Expense Management:

  • Process and reconcile expense reports and invoices.

  • Track and manage the CEO’s budget for travel, entertainment, and other expenses.

  • Personal Support:

  • Provide personal assistance as required, which may include managing personal appointments, household tasks, or other personal errands.
